NABARD Grade A Interview: Basics

Building a career as a NABARD Employee is a dream of many aspirants. Therefore, over 1 lakh students enrolled for the NABARD Grade A 2023 Exam. However, the total number of vacancies announced for NABARD Grade A 2023 was only 150. The NABARD Grade A notification was announced on September 2 and processed till September 23, 2023. The Prelims exam was held on October 16, 2023, and Mains on November 19, 2023. However, the Mains Exam result is yet to be announced, but all the aspirants now have their eyes on the interview. Interview for the post of NABARD Grade A is very important for your final section for the post. 

NABARD Grade A Interview 2023 carries a maximum weightage of 50 marks, and your selection will be based on your aggregate score in Phase 2 exam and interview i.e. total marks obtained out of 250. You should remember that the selection ratio of the NABARD Grade A Mains exam is 1:25. Therefore, the competition will be at the God level.

Preparation Tips for NABARD Grade A Interview 

Master the NABARD Grade A Interview with strategic preparation. Daily news reading, focusing on the economy, agriculture, and rural issues, is vital. Explore editorials in leading newspapers and dive into specialized publications like Kurukshetra. Utilize resources such as the Economic Survey and NABARD Annual Report. Familiarize yourself with the NABARD website and supplement your knowledge with insights from financial news channels. Additionally, delve into government reports for a comprehensive understanding.

Presentation-Based Interview in NABARD

In previous years, NABARD has occasionally conducted interviews featuring presentations or sharing newspaper clippings with candidates. However, candidates need not worry about the format, as the interview primarily revolves around their profiles and current topics. Remember that the interview is not a mere knowledge test but a conversation assessing human resource and people management abilities is crucial. Responses should adopt a conversational mode rather than a strict question-answer approach, allowing candidates to introduce exciting aspects that may prompt board members to delve deeper with additional questions.

NABARD Grade A Interview Preparation: Dressing Tips

Regardless of gender, the fundamental rule of dressing for the NABARD Grade A interview is prioritizing comfort. The selected attire should project professionalism and instill confidence, allowing candidates to present themselves positively during the interview. But there are some codes of conduct that both males and females need to adhere to, which are mentioned below:  

Dressing Guidelines for Male Candidates:

When selecting attire for the NABARD Grade A interview, male candidates are advised to project a professional image through their clothing. A formal, light-colored, full-sleeved shirt and dark-colored trousers are recommended. Complementing the ensemble, black formal shoes and socks matching the trouser color contribute to a polished appearance. Accessorize with a black formal belt featuring a decent buckle, and consider the optional use of a tie and coat or blazer, especially if comfortable and weather-appropriate. To complete the look, keep a light-colored, clean handkerchief on hand for added refinement.

However, certain dressing practices are discouraged for male candidates. Shirts with checks, floral patterns, or linings, as are jeans or casual pants, are to be avoided. White socks should not be paired with dark-colored trousers, and the choice of footwear should steer clear of brown, casual, sport, or track shoes for the interview.

Dressing Guidelines for Female Candidates:

Female candidates have several options for interview attire. A plain-colored Indian saree, preferably cotton, imparts a formal and mature appearance. Alternatively, an Indian or a formal business suit can be chosen, with a preference for simple and sober colors and patterns. Minimal jewelry or none at all is recommended, prioritizing simplicity and maturity. The choice between a saree, Indian, or Western suit should be based on personal comfort and preference.

Conversely, there are certain dressing practices that female candidates should avoid. Dresses with very bright colors and flowery patterns, along with those featuring heavy embroidery and metal objects, are not recommended. Jewelry should be limited, with simple bangles and earrings sufficing. Light makeup is encouraged, emphasizing simplicity to convey sincerity during the interview. Additionally, very high-heel sandals should be avoided, particularly those that produce noise on tiled floors.

List of important NABARD Grade A Interview Questions 

1. Why do you want to work with NABARD?

2. How will your work experience (educational background) help you work with NABARD?

3. What do you know about NABARD?

4. What are the challenges in your present job? (if you are already working)

5. What is the best part of your job? (if you are already working)

6. What are your hobbies and interests?

7. Have you prepared for UPSC (Civil Services)? What are your career goals?

8. How shall India deal with the growing unemployment problem when a significant number of people depend on the agriculture sector?

9. What are the significant challenges faced by banks in India?

10. What are the significant financial institutions for rural credit?

11. What are the significant challenges of the agriculture sector in India?

12. Why have you become a NABARD officer/bank clerk?
